| Specification | Linx Hypnos Zero | Stache E-Nail |
|---|---|---|
| Price (USD) | $80 | $190 |
| Temperature Range | — | 700-1000℉ |
| Chamber Capacity | ~0.1 gram | — |
| Battery Capacity | 650mAh | — |
| Height | 10cm | — |
| Power Adjustment | Modular Control - 4 stages | — |
| Brand | Linx Vapor | Stache |
| Thread Type | 510 Thread | — |
The biggest practical difference is price tier: the Linx Hypnos Zero sits at $80 while the Stache E-Nail is $190, a gap of about $110 that puts them in different buying brackets.
Linx Hypnos Zero is the cheaper option at $80 compared with $190 for the Stache E-Nail, about $110 less. Live retailer pricing can shift, so confirm before buying.
Linx Hypnos Zero is the better pick if low-profile use matters. It's tagged as stealth or pocket-friendly in our database, while the Stache E-Nail is more conspicuous in hand and harder to keep out of sight.
Stache E-Nail is the better fit for microdosing in our database, typically thanks to a smaller chamber, finer temperature control, or both.
